Speedy Cat #30

I made several holiday cards at a ladies day workshop this weekend.  I left my bg stamp at home by mistake and borrowed this Embossing Folder by cuttlebug from my daughter. I inked the folder with black ink and got three impressions out of it in varying shades and they all looked nice.  This one was one of the the third time through so the black is quite light.  The greeting on the red strip and the holly leaves are from Mark's Finest Paper Musical Holiday Set and the black circular frame is from MFP Frames and Flourishes set. Inside is the rest of the greeting that says this Joyous Holiday Season
